Abstract
An Italian manufacturer of uniforms for hotel, hospital and food preparation workers, Amuco International SpA, of Avellino, near Naples, is profiled. The company produces more than a million uniforms a year, retaining its competitive position by constantly updating its computerized equipment. Pattern-making, cutting, sewing and finishing processes are described.
